GEEHAW JAUNT - Register Online

The skijoring race for everyone!

Sunday, January 22rd 11:00 am races start
Course begins at Boulder Lake Environmental Center’s warming shack, goes across the lake and around the Bear Paw loop.

One Dog Teams:

  • Beginning Racer and Dog: 1 lap (3.04k)
  • Advanced Racer and Dog: 2 laps (5.34k)

One or Two Dog Teams:

  • Pro Racer and Dog(s): 3 laps (7.64k)
  • Classic or skate technique

Prize drawing and Hot Lunch for all registered Racers
